Changemyaddress.com Official site for US Post Office used for COA but was billed 19.95 by this company Internet
*Consumer Comment: Are you sure?
I went online to the official US Post Office site as per their form to do a fwd address report. When I received my Visa bill via L L Bean, I was charged 19.95 by changemyaddress.com dated 05/26/13.
I tried calling them but the mailbox was full, so I called LL Bean and filed a protest and the charge was removed from my account.
I noticed that others had the same problem so decided to file a ripoff report.
